I've finally got a vdo gauge and sender fitted courtesy of brickwerks :ok to my jr engined westy multivan.
I was a bit concerned towards the end of last year when a small piece of white metal came out with the old oil and feared the worst.
I was encouraged by the readings today but what does anyone think?
Cold start idle 4bar
Cold start 2000rpm 4.3bar
Hot idle 0.6 bar
Hot 2000rpm 1.5 bar ( it picks up to this figure fairly quickly when revved)

Seems fine,mine is about the same,cold idle 4.5 ,hot idle .9/1bar,hot at 3000 rpm3 bar on a "sb" I do have a front mounted oil cooler though.
Without the oil cooler the oil gets to 130 deg c!! On my test hill (3 gear for 10 minutes at30 deg c ambient)
